How To Choose The Best Plain White T Shirts For Women

A white tee is the most scrutinized piece in any closet. Reveal too much through the fabric, pull at the seams after a dozen wears, or shrink into a crop top—and you’re back to square one. Here’s what separates the keepers from the compost.

Fabric Weight and Opacity

The single biggest complaint about white tees is sheerness. If the fabric weight falls below roughly 140 GSM, you’ll see your bra straps and skin tone through the shirt. Heavier fabric (160–200 GSM range) drapes better and stays opaque without feeling stiff. Look for cotton that feels dense but not cardboard-like when you pinch the hem.

Neckline and Shoulder Fit

A scoop neck that sits too low or a crew neck that rubs your collarbone can ruin the silhouette. Ribbed crew necks hold their shape better than single-jersey necks, which often stretch into a floppy oval after a few wears. Also check where the shoulder seam hits—if it hangs past your natural shoulder line, the whole tee looks slouchy instead of intentional.

Laundry Recovery and Shrinkage

Every white tee will shrink to some degree. The question is whether it recovers. Cheap cuts twist at the side seams and curl at the hem after drying. The best white tees use preshrunk ring-spun cotton or a cotton-poly blend so the dimensions remain predictable after wash number ten.

FAQ

How can I tell if a white tee will be see-through before I buy it?
Look for fabric weight (GSM) details in the product description or reviews. A GSM of 160 or higher is generally opaque. If the descriptions mention “soft” and “lightweight” without any weight number, assume it’s sheer. Real customer photos tagged as “wearing white” are the best check: if you can see the bra in a photo under reasonable lighting, it will probably be sheer in real life.
Should I buy 100% cotton or a cotton-blend for a white tee?
100% cotton drapes beautifully and breathes well, but it shrinks more and develops pinhole tears faster. A cotton-poly or cotton-spandex blend (90% cotton / 10% elastane is common) resists shrinkage, recovers from washing cycles, and keeps the shoulder seams straight. For a white tee that you wash weekly, a blend almost always outlasts pure cotton.
